ABSTRACT

The research was poised in finding out whether accounting profession is a panacea in the recapitalization and thus ascertained equally how the knowledge of professional accountants bring positive impact in the recapitalization of Nigerian banks.  One of the objectives of the study is examine the reasons for neglecting Accounting models and techniques in addressing bank financial issue/recapitalization.  The population variable of 132 employees of selected banks and a sample size of 99 were highly utilized.  Four hypotheses were formulated and tested with Z test method of data analysis, using four liket type.  Among other things one of the major finding were that Accounting profession is imperative n the recapitalization of Nigerian banks.  The researcher concluded that recapitalization cannot work-out without Accounting profession.  Finally, Nigerian banks should involve the service of professional Accountant in top decision making and recapitalization.

 

 

 

 

 

CHAPTER 1

Background of the study

Accounting is the classification, recording and analyzing of business transaction either to prepare periodic statement of performance or provide information for management and decision making. Penguin management hand book (1987) defines profession as an occupation possessing high social status and characterize by considerable skills and knowledge much of which is the theoretical and intellectual in nature. The possession of such skill is usually tested by formal examination approved by authoritative body. Therefore, accounting profession can be seen as a systematic undertaken using proficiency to arrive at information base in solving foreseeable accounting problems.

Recapitalization is an undertaken which involves restructuring a company’s debt and equity mixture, most often with the aim of making a company’s capital structure more stable, reliable and stronger. Essentially, the process involve the exchange of one form of financing for another, such as removing preference shares from the company’s capital structure and replacing them with bond. Recapitalization is the basis for mergers and acquisition. In the year 2005, banks were obliged to keep a minimum requirement of 25billion naira by the CBN Governor, Charles Soludo with full compliance before ending of December 2005. This is move by the CBN which expresses hope for the Nigeria banking industry but however, banks who cannot meet up with the minimum requirement were prone with the option of mergers and acquisition.

The increase in capital requirement for licensed bank to a new minimum base of 25billion is intended to radically redefine the financial services industry scope on Nigeria. The stated objectives of consolidation of the banking sector include ensuring that a fewer but stronger banks emerge by effective date December 2005. To meet the challenges of the new capitalization, many banks will explore mergers and acquisition.

Accounting profession as a solution in the recapitalization of banks entails the overall calculations that comes to play in forming a syndicate. Because recapitalization can only be achieved when the professional accountants are able to ascertain whether or not each of the banks financial record and directors report are correct for mergers and acquisition to be possible.

The central bank of Nigeria (CBN) announced a new capital requirement of 25billion naira for Nigeria banks (about 181m USD), this reflect an increase from its previous 2billion naira (about 4.5m USD). This unexpected increase has inevitably led to mergers and acquisition plan by affected banks.  The professional accountant here, is faced with challenges of buying the liabilities and conversions of assets of both banks to form a consolidated and stronger banks depending on the merger and acquisition plan.

The move by the CBN is geared towards restoring the confidence of the public reposed in the financial system (banking industries) this is because a number of small banks often prone with unaccountability and corruption, and it is likely that many banks would merge and Nigeria will end up with better capitalization of banks. Accounting profession is the engine room  that holds the functional application of the above because mergers and acquisition plans has created the vacuum which an accountant must cover. That is,  using the knowledge of accounting profession to solve identified problems that may arise due to the effect of mergers and acquisition plan in order to avoid or solve  the vicissitudes that may arise at the long run, and to be able to detect fraud in the financial statement of both banks that are going into mergers and acquisition.

Definition of terms

  • Bank: According to the Nigerian banking act 1967 (as amended banks

amended act 1979) a bank is described as the business of receiving money from outside sources as deposits irrespective of the payment of interest and the granting of money, loan and acceptance of credit or the purchase and sale of securities for account of those or the incurring of obligation to acquire claims directive of loans prior to their maturing or the commissioner may on the recommendation of the central bank by order published in the federal gazette designed as banking business.

  • Investment: investment is ploughing one’s finance or funds into project or assets (be it tangible or financial assets) with a view to be increasing one’s wealth.
  • Merger: merger has been defined as the fusing together two or more companies “whether the fusion was voluntarily or enforced” on the other hand, the companies are joined together to submerge their separate identities into a new company formed to acquire the assets and liabilities of the liquidated companies. These are the reasons why pandey defines merger as the fusion of two or more case of a big company swallowing others. In the case of forming an entirely new corporation or entity which acquire the asset of all the combined companies, This system is called a consolidation. In Nigeria, both cases are referred as a merger.

 

  • Statutory consolidation: Here both firms merge into a brand new firm

While the affected firms cases exist as separate firms shares of the new company are exchanged for the  shares of the old companies. The new firms subsequently assumes the asset and liabilities of the old companies.

  • Acquisition: Acquisition has been defined as a series of transaction

Whereby a person (individual, group of individual or company acquires and control over the assets either directly by becoming  the owner of those assets or indirectly by obtaining control of the management of the company.

  • Capital base: This means the paid up capital and reserves unimpaired by

Losses.

  • Paid up capital: This includes ordinary shares plus non redeemable

Preference shares.

  • Accounting issue: The valuation of the shares should be carried out and be reputable and independent.

The valuation method should be agreed by all the parties for the purpose determining the consideration. The valuation principle must consistently applied to all parties involve in  the combination. Any revaluation of fixed assets carried out in the case of a merge should   not be incorporated into the financial records of the consolidated banks except as approved by the CBN. The valuation should be satisfaction of the CBN that such  a revaluation represent the fair value of the asset acquired.
